Mahabharata Udyoga Parva – न हि कृत्स्नतमॊ धर्मः शक्यः पराप्तुम इति शरुतिः

Shloka (श्लोक)

न हि कृत्स्नतमॊ धर्मः शक्यः पराप्तुम इति शरुतिः
परिग्रहवता तन मे परत्यक्षम अरिसूदन

⚡ Quick Meaning

It is said that the complete form of dharma cannot be attained by one who clings to possessions; this is evident to me, O enemy-slayer.

Translations

English Translation

This shloka emphasizes that true dharma, or righteousness, is unattainable for those who are attached to material possessions. The speaker asserts their realization of this truth, suggesting that spiritual purity requires the abandonment of worldly ties.

Commentary

Context

This verse illustrates a key tenet of spiritual growth, pointing out the hindrances that material attachments can impose on the pursuit of dharma.

Meaning

The underlying lesson stresses the importance of detachment and the realization that true fulfillment lies beyond superficial gains.

Application

This serves as a reminder to seek a deeper understanding of life by prioritizing spiritual over material wealth, fostering a mindset of minimalism and gratitude.
